Currently sat bottom of the 36-team Uefa Champions League league phase heading into round four, Slovan Bratislava know they need to start picking up points soon if they are to have any chance of finishing in the top 24, which would see the Slovakians compete in a two-legged knock-out phase play-off.

Meanwhile, their opponents on Tuesday (17:45, TNT Sports 4), Dinamo Zagreb, are unbeaten in their last two European outings and reside on four points. Team News

Manchester City Academy graduate Robert Mak and former Watford midfielder Juraj Kucka are both missing for Slovan Bratislava on Tuesday due to injury. The experienced Slovakian duo are joined in the treatment room by ex-Stoke City and Tottenham Hotspur defender Kevin Wimmer, who scored his side's only league phase goal so far in the 5-1 defeat to Celtic in Glasgow.

Sharani Zuberu, Julius Szoke and Adler are also expected to miss out in midweek.

Dinamo Zagreb and Croatia striker Bruno Petkovic, who has scored twice in the league phase so far, missed Friday's 4-0 win over Sibenik and will have to watch from the sideline in Bratislava.

The same can be said for goalkeeper Ivan Nevistic so Danijel Zagorac will deputise between the sticks again.

There are also doubts over the availability of Arijan Ademi, who was withdrawn at half-time last Friday.

Firstly, I'm expecting both teams to score on Tuesday. Slovan and Dinamo have each conceded 11 goals in three league phase games; the former are yet to keep a clean sheet in the competition while the latter's only one came last time out in Salzburg when the hosts were reduced to 10 men in the 66th minute.

Both teams have scored in seven of Dinamo's last 10 matches in all competitions and eight of Slovan's last 12.

Before a ball was kicked in the league phase, this is a game that both sides will have targeted as one they could, and should, be getting all three points, and without a win or draw to their name yet, Tuesday takes on even more importance for the hosts.

Slovan's final four fixtures are against AC Milan (H), Atletico Madrid (A), Stuttgart (H) and Bayern Munich (A), and you'd be hard-pressed to back them for three points, let alone one, in any of those matches.

Therefore, they simply have to go for it this week, conditions that should lend themselves to an entertaining encounter in Bratislava.

On the other side, Zagreb would be more content with a stalemate having recovered from their round one routing by Bayern, who annihilated them 9-2 in Munich.

The Croatians have more winnable matches remaining, notably home games against Borussia Dortmund and Celtic next before taking a trip to Arsenal and ending in Zagreb v AC Milan.

However, they will want to maintain momentum in the competition and ensure qualification as quickly as possible so as not to have to rely on achieving positive results against the likes of Arsenal.

Dinamo have scored in their last 10 matches, including all three league phase fixtures so far in the Champions League, so they will be confident of finding the net at least once on Tuesday against the joint-leakiest defence in the competition.

Both teams to score looks likely for me, and I'm adding in the double chance result on the visitors as well.

After their humiliation in Bavaria, Dinamo have shown tremendous powers of recovery, holding AS Monaco to a 2-2 draw in Zagreb before beating Salzburg 2-0 in Austria last time out.

Slovan, meanwhile, have been easily beaten in all three league phase games so far, although their only home match has been against reigning English Premier League champions Manchester City, so that's probably not a great indication of what they are really like at home.

Armenian attacker Tigran Barseghyan is Slovan's top goalscorer this season with 12 strikes in all competitions - 10 in the Slovak First Football League, and two in Champions League qualifying.

The 31-year-old is yet to get off the mark in the league phase but was responsible for one of just three shots attempted by Slovan against Man City and saw an effort saved by Girona goalkeeper Paulo Gazzaniga last time out in Europe.

With Mak and Kucka out, there is even more responsibility on his and striker David Strelec's shoulders, particularly in the final third of the pitch.

Barseghyan has scored in his two most recent matches and has three in his last four, so he comes into Tuesday's contest in good form.
